Can two LP2951\s be put in parallel to boost current?

Paralleling the LP2951 to get more current is a poor solution as this requires balancing the current between the two devices via small resistor (0.1Ω) in series with each of the outputs. This results in poor regulation because of the voltage drop across the resistor. A better approach is, of course, to use a higher current rating device. The other approach we suggest is using PNP transistor to boost the current, the down side to this approach is the addition of Vbe drop which means the minimum input must be higher than output by about 1.5V.
